On Wednesday, April 25 the Weisman Art Museum's student group, WAM Collective, in conjunction with Northrop Concerts and Lectures, will present No White, a runway show featuring the sixteen finalists from a design competition held in March.
Students were challenged to design a costume in response to the Ballet Preljocaj's production of Snow White (presented by the Northrop earlier this month), focusing on the villainy, murder, passion, and deception underpinning fairy tales.
Per the title of the event, no white is allowed in the final design.
The show starts at 7:30 p.m., but don't miss the pre-show party featuring WAM's signature cocktail of the evening: the Poisoned Apple.
